cathetus
Meaning
A line perpendicular to a surface (or line); in particular, either of the sides of a right triangle other than its hypotenuse.
Pronounced as (IPA)
/ˈkæ.θɪ.təs/
Etymology
From Latin cathetus, from Ancient Greek κάθετος (káthetos, “perpendicular”).
